					<description><![CDATA[<p>Genius has released its DVR-FHD590 Full HD Vehicle Recorder. This dash camera records crisp and clear Full HD (1920&#215;1080) video that helps drivers protect themselves with reliable evidence in the case of an unforeseen accident. An wide-angle lens, high power LED for night capture, and HDR technology ensures excellent video quality when you need it &#8230;</p>

					<description><![CDATA[<p>Micron Technology has announced the introduction of the industry&#8217;s smallest 128GB NAND flash memory device.  This new NAND flash module utilizes Micron&#8217;s award-winning 20nm architecture with triple-level cells (TLC), which are able to store three bits of information per cell.  This creates a highly compact storage solution, targeted at cost-competitive removable storage applications such as &#8230;</p>
